Abstract

Using data from our recent experiment on inclusive μ-pair production by 150-GeV/c protons on beryllium, we have calculated the contribution of muon pairs to the yield of single prompt muons. We find, both at 90° in the center-of-mass system and in the forward direction, that the resulting single-muon cross sections are in reasonable agreement with the existing measurements for which only one muon is detected.
